Что такое алгоритмы и как они задействуются в современных технологиях

Что такое алгоритмы и как они задействуются в современных технологиях

Алгоритмы являют собой последовательность чётко заданных инструкций для разрешения конкретной задачи. Каждый алгоритм содержит исходные данные и ожидаемый результат. Актуальные решения задействуют алгоритмы на каждом этапе функционирования цифровых комплексов.

Программные программы состоят из множества алгоритмов, которые анализируют данные и осуществляют различные действия. Смартфоны применяют алгоритмы для идентификации лиц и оптимизации функционирования аккумулятора. Интернет-сервисы используют казино без депозита для индивидуализации материала.

Поисковые системы применяют запутанные алгоритмы для ранжирования веб-страниц и выдачи соответствующих данных. Социальные сети применяют алгоритмы для составления новостной подборки каждого юзера.

Финансовые структуры используют алгоритмы для исследования угроз и обнаружения преступных транзакций. Транспортные системы используют казино для улучшения путей и регулирования движением.

Развитие решений способствовало к созданию алгоритмов машинного обучения и синтетического разума. Эти алгоритмы рассматривают паттерны и строят предсказания на основе больших объёмов данных.

Толкование алгоритма и его ключевые особенности

Алгоритм является ясным описанием череды операций, направленных на получение установленного итога. Математики и программисты выработали формальное определение алгоритма как ограниченного набора правил, подходящих к первоначальным сведениям.

Любой алгоритм обладает комплектом основных характеристик, которые выделяют его от элементарной команды:

  • Дискретность предполагает разделение хода на изолированные первичные стадии
  • Определённость диктует чёткого толкования каждого шага
  • Результативность обеспечивает обретение результата за определённое число действий
  • Универсальность обеспечивает применять алгоритм к полному классу проблем

Определённые алгоритмы всегда выдают равный результат при одних и тех же стартовых информации. Вероятностные алгоритмы применяют казино онлайн для обретения результата с установленной уровнем правильности.

Производительность алгоритма измеряется по периоду реализации и размеру применяемой памяти. Наилучшие алгоритмы решают задание с наименьшими расходами компьютерных мощностей.

Роль алгоритмов в повседневной виртуальной действительности

Современный человек ежедневно работает с десятками алгоритмов, часто не замечая их присутствия. Утренний будильник на смартфоне применяет алгоритмы для отслеживания стадий сна и подбора наилучшего момента подъёма. Навигационные приложения используют алгоритмы для вычисления пути с рассмотрением транспортной обстановки.

Мобильные банковские утилиты применяют казино без депозита для осуществления переводов и контроля надёжности транзакций. Камеры смартфонов задействуют алгоритмы для оптимизации качества снимков. Голосовые ассистенты распознают голос благодаря сложным алгоритмам изучения аудио.

Онлайн-магазины применяют алгоритмы для выбора товаров на фундаменте хроники посещений. Музыкальные платформы генерируют личные подборки, изучая вкусы слушателя. Видеоплатформы рекомендуют материал с помощью алгоритмов, исследующих поведение пользователей.

Интеллектуальные здания используют алгоритмы для роботизации подсветки и отопления. Фитнес-трекеры подсчитывают шаги и калории с помощью анализа информации с датчиков. Алгоритмы сделались неотъемлемой частью ежедневной жизни.

Алгоритмы в поисковых системах и рекомендательных службах

Поисковые системы выполняют миллиарды вопросов ежедневно, задействуя сложные алгоритмы ранжирования результатов. Эти алгоритмы рассматривают контент веб-страниц, их соответствие вопросу и достоверность источника. Поисковые системы применяют казино онлайн для выбора максимально релевантных итогов.

Алгоритмы упорядочивания учитывают массу элементов при формировании результатов:

  • Совпадение содержимого поисковому запросу юзера
  • Уровень и уникальность письменного материала веб-страницы
  • Количество и уровень гиперссылок, ведущих на страницу
  • Темп загрузки и удобство применения ресурса

Советующие системы задействуют алгоритмы совместной отбора для предсказания вкусов. Контентные алгоритмы исследуют параметры товаров для выбора подобных опций. Комбинированные системы объединяют несколько подходов для улучшения достоверности советов.

Алгоритмы компьютерного обучения постоянно улучшают качество нахождения. Системы рассматривают действия пользователей и продолжительность изучения для повышения результатов.

Применение алгоритмов в социальных сетях

Социальные сети используют алгоритмы для формирования персонализированной подборки новостей каждого пользователя. Платформы изучают взаимодействия с материалом, чтобы показывать максимально занимательные публикации. Алгоритмы анализируют лайки, замечания и время ознакомления для установления релевантности содержимого.

Алгоритмы социальных сетей используют казино без депозита для ранжирования материалов товарищей и сообществ. Системы учитывают новизну содержимого и известность автора. Видеоконтент часто обретает приоритет в результатах благодаря алгоритмам раскрутки.

Рекламные алгоритмы выбирают целевую публику на основе предпочтений и поведения пользователей. Платформы применяют алгоритмы для противостояния с запрещённым материалом и спамом. Системы модерации автоматически обнаруживают отступления требований сообщества.

Алгоритмы предлагают новых товарищей и увлекательные объединения на базе наличествующих связей. Социальные сети применяют казино для анализа графа социальных контактов и выявления совместных предпочтений. Платформы регулярно совершенствуют алгоритмы для повышения пользовательского восприятия.

Алгоритмы в финансовых технологиях и онлайн-платежах

Финансовые учреждения задействуют алгоритмы для обработки миллионов транзакций постоянно. Банковские системы используют алгоритмы кодирования для защиты приватных сведений потребителей. Расчётные платформы верифицируют законность транзакций с помощью казино онлайн изучения поведенческих шаблонов.

Алгоритмы выявления мошенничества изучают каждую операцию в формате реального момента. Системы учитывают местоположение, величину перевода и запись транзакций. Сомнительные транзакции блокируются самостоятельно для недопущения материальных убытков.

Кредитный скоринг задействует алгоритмы для определения платёжеспособности заёмщиков. Системы изучают кредитную запись и экономические показатели. Алгоритмы способствуют финансовым учреждениям выносить постановления о оформлении займов быстрее.

Торговые алгоритмы на площадках осуществляют сделки за доли секунды. Скоростная трейдинг задействует алгоритмы для исследования торговых информации. Криптовалютные сервисы применяют бездепозитный бонус казино для осуществления распределённых платежей. Алгоритмы оптимизируют сборы и быстроту осуществления переводов.

Использование алгоритмов в развлекательных платформах

Видеостриминговые сервисы задействуют алгоритмы для персонализации рекомендаций контента. Платформы анализируют хронику обзоров и рейтинги кинолент для отбора уместных материалов. Алгоритмы учитывают жанровые вкусы и востребованность содержимого среди подобных пользователей.

Музыкальные приложения используют алгоритмы для формирования автоматических подборок на фундаменте состояния аудитории. Системы изучают темп треков и стили для создания согласованных списков. Алгоритмы радио используют казино без депозита для селекции похожих песен и обнаружения свежих музыкантов.

Игровые платформы используют алгоритмы для выбора соперников с подобным уровнем навыка. Системы матчмейкинга обеспечивают уравновешенные команды и увлекательные игровые сессии. Алгоритмы генерации материала генерируют оригинальные уровни в проектах.

Подкаст-приложения задействуют алгоритмы для предложения эпизодов по увлечениям пользователя. Сервисы виртуальных книг используют для предложения произведений похожих жанров. Алгоритмы гибкого стриминга подстраивают уровень ролика под быстроту связи.

Алгоритмы надёжности и защиты сведений

Криптографические алгоритмы гарантируют приватность пересылки данных в сети. Системы шифрования конвертируют данные в непонятный формат для обеспечения от незаконного доступа. Алгоритмы асимметричного кодирования задействуют набор ключей для защищённого обмена посланиями.

Алгоритмы хеширования создают оригинальные цифровые хеши файлов и паролей. Системы держат хеши паролей вместо оригинальных величин для улучшения безопасности. Алгоритмы верифицируют неизменность информации и определяют правки в документах.

Антивирусные приложения задействуют алгоритмы сигнатурного исследования для выявления известных опасностей. Системы действенного исследования задействуют для выявления свежих видов вредоносного цифрового ПО.

Системы двухэтапной аутентификации задействуют алгоритмы генерации одноразовых паролей для обеспечения учётных аккаунтов. Биометрические алгоритмы распознают отпечатки пальцев и лица. Межсетевые фильтры используют для фильтрации интернет трафика и запрета подозрительных соединений.

Компьютерное обучение и искусственный разум на основе алгоритмов

Алгоритмы компьютерного обучения обеспечивают компьютерным системам тренироваться на данных без прямого кодирования. Нейронные сети задействуют многоуровневые алгоритмы для идентификации шаблонов и формирования решений. Системы продвинутого обучения применяют казино для изучения изображений, текста и аудио.

Алгоритмы тренировки с наставником работают с размеченными информацией для классификации и предсказания. Системы обучаются на случаях с известными корректными решениями. Алгоритмы обучения без учителя обнаруживают латентные закономерности в сведениях.

Алгоритмы обработки обычного наречия позволяют машинам осознавать человеческую говор. Системы автоматизированного конвертации задействуют нейронные сети для трансформации текста между наречиями. Чат-боты задействуют алгоритмы для ведения разговоров с юзерами.

Машинное зрение задействует алгоритмы для определения элементов на изображениях. Самоуправляемые транспортные средства задействуют казино онлайн для навигации на пути. Медицинские системы применяют алгоритмы для определения патологий по снимкам.

Влияние алгоритмов на пользовательский впечатление

Алгоритмы формируют цифровой восприятие миллиардов участников ежедневно. Настройка контента превращает общение с службами более удобным и уместным. Системы подстраиваются под индивидуальные интересы, сберегая время на поиск данных.

Алгоритмы совершенствования оболочек повышают перемещение и упрощают осуществление задач. Системы A/B тестирования используют казино для отбора максимально успешных решений дизайна. Адаптивные алгоритмы подстраивают вывод контента под величину экрана устройства.

Прогностические алгоритмы прогнозируют действия юзеров и предлагают релевантные рекомендации. Автозаполнение форм и рекомендации обращений ускоряют взаимодействие с сервисами. Алгоритмы сохранения обеспечивают скоростную загрузку часто используемых сведений.

Однако избыточная персонализация формирует сведений коконы, сужая вариативность содержимого. Участники получают лишь содержимое, подходящие их существующим мнениям. Алгоритмы способны увеличивать предвзятость и клише. Открытость действия алгоритмов становится важным условием для формирования доверия к цифровым платформам.